In five sets of studies in the laboratory and one field study at comedy performances, Dr. Dunbar and colleagues tested resistance to pain both before and after bouts of social laughter. The pain came from a freezing wine sleeve slipped over a forearm, an ever tightening blood pressure cuff or an excruciating ski exercise.
The findings, published in the Proceedings of the Royal Society B: Biological Sciences, eliminated the possibility that the pain resistance measured was the result of a general sense of well being rather than actual laughter. And, Dr. Dunbar said, they also provided a partial answer to the ageless conundrum of whether we laugh because we feel giddy or feel giddy because we laugh.
“The causal sequence is laughter triggers endorphin activation,” he said. What triggers laughter is a question that leads into a different labyrinth.
